Crime overview for Windsor and Maidenhead district

Windsor and Maidenhead has the 24th lowest crime rate of 64 districts in South East region and the 90th lowest crime rate district of 318 districts in England and Wales. Within the region (South East), it has the 24th lowest crime rate of 64 districts.

The overall crime rate in Windsor and Maidenhead in the last 12 months was 68.8 per 1,000 residents and was 17.9% lower than the South East region average (83.8 per 1,000 residents). In the last 12 months, Windsor and Maidenhead’s most reported crimes were Violence and sexual offences with 3,929 offences recorded. The least common crime was Possession of weapons with 85 cases , down -34.1% compared to 2024. The fastest-growing crime category was Robbery ( 38.1% YoY). The sharpest decline was Possession of weapons ( -34.1% YoY).

Violent crimes totalled 4,967 (β‰ˆ 32.1 per 1,000 residents). Year-over-year these were flat ( -0.7% ). Over the last decade, overall crime has falling ( -27.7% comparing early vs recent averages) .
